Context: The Same Old Playbook
This isn’t the first time a mega-event has flirted with blockchain. In 2022, the World Cup in Qatar saw a flurry of fan tokens—Chiliz’s $CHZ and various club tokens. The result? A predictable spike during the group stage, followed by a 60% drawdown within three months. The narrative was “decentralized fan ownership.” The reality was centralized token minting with a hard-coded vesting schedule. Now, FIFA is dusting off that playbook with Avalanche’s subnet architecture as the new stage. The context here is critical: the market is in a bear phase, capital is scarce, and projects are desperate for attention. Tying yourself to the 2026 World Cup is a survival move—a bid to capture the next wave of retail liquidity before the hype cycle peaks. But I’ve seen this movie before. The same small user base gets sliced into thinner pieces across L2s and sidechains. Scaling isn’t happening; liquidity fragmentation is.
Core: Systematic Teardown
Let’s break this down with forensic precision. First, the technical layer: what does “Avalanche play” actually mean? Avalanche offers subnets—customizable blockchains that can handle high throughput and low latency. On paper, this is ideal for a global event like the World Cup, where millions of fans might mint tickets or vote on goal-of-the-tournament. But the announcement provides zero detail. Is FIFA launching its own subnet? Will it use the C-Chain? Who runs the validators? Without answers, we’re left with a handshake agreement, not a technical integration. I’ve audited enough Solidity code to know that a handshake can hide a reentrancy vulnerability. They built on sand; I built on skepticism.
Second, the tokenomics layer. Fan tokens have a notorious track record. They are utility tokens with governance rights over trivial decisions—like the color of the team bus. Their value is 100% dependent on narrative momentum. When the match ends, the hype evaporates. For the 2026 World Cup, the expected timeline is a classic “buy the rumor, sell the news” pattern. By late 2025, the token will likely be priced in. By July 2026, the exit liquidity will be gone. The insiders—the teams, the foundation, the early backers—will have already cashed out. The code doesn’t lie: check the wallet balances of the team behind similar tokens. The distribution is almost always skewed toward the creators.
Third, the regulatory layer. The 2026 World Cup is hosted by the United States, Canada, and Mexico. The U.S. SEC has been aggressive on tokens that pass the Howey test. Fan tokens are borderline: they require a monetary investment, they depend on the efforts of a centralized entity (FIFA), and buyers often expect profit. If FIFA issues a native token, it could be classified as a security, triggering registration requirements or even enforcement actions. The safest path is to issue non-transferable NFTs or mere points, but then the “blockchain” part is redundant. It becomes a traditional loyalty program with extra gas fees. Contrarian: What the Bulls Got Right
To be fair, the optimists have a point. Avalanche’s subnet technology is genuinely suited for high-throughput, low-latency applications. If FIFA builds a dedicated subnet with a robust validator set, it could handle millions of transactions during peak match days without congestion. That’s a real technical advantage over, say, Ethereum mainnet or even Polygon. Also, FIFA’s brand power is immense. It could onboard millions of non-crypto users who suddenly need a wallet to access exclusive content or vote on highlights. That’s a user acquisition channel most protocols can only dream of. But remember: user acquisition doesn’t equate to value retention. The 2022 World Cup saw 5 million users on Socios.com, but the token price still collapsed. Bulls argue that this time is different because Avalanche’s subnets allow for custom tokenomics—like deflationary mechanisms or staking rewards tied to match attendance. That might slow the bleed, but it won’t reverse it. The fundamental dynamic remains: event-driven hype is unsustainable.
